Ingersoll Man Charged With Attempted Murder

Oxford OPP have charged a 22 year old man with attempted murder after shots were fired in Zorra Township.

INGERSOLL - A 22 year old man from Ingersoll has been charged with attempted murder. 

Oxford OPP were called out to Road 78 in Zorra Township just after midnight on Sunday February 12th. They were contacted by a citizen reporting a weapon related incident. Police say the young man from Ingersoll came to the home an got into an argument with the residents. At some point during the fight, he fired a shot. No injuries have been reported. 

Teddy Harvey was eventually arrested in Waterloo and he is now facing the following charges:

- Attempt Murder
- Pointing a Firearm (2 counts)
- Careless Use of Firearm
- Possession of a Weapon for Dangerous Purpose
- Assault with a Weapon
- Theft Under $5,000
- Theft Over $5000
- Possession of property Obtained by Crime Under $5,000
- Possession of Property Obtained by Crime Over $5000
- Break and Enter
- Possession of break in tools
- Possession of a loaded restricted firearm

He is being held in custody pending a bail hearing to answer to the charges. An investigation is ongoing and anyone with information on this incident is asked to contact police at 1-888-310-1122.
